We are looking for two experienced Corporate Lawyers to join the Leeds team, at Associate, Senior Associate or Principal Associate level. Candidates are expected to contribute proactively to business development activity and develop close working relationships with appropriate office contacts throughout the national and international network.
Skills and Experience
- 3-8 years of Post Qualified Experience in Corporate law.
- Ability to manage competing client demands and work flexibly to tight deadlines.
- Excellent client service delivery, drive, enthusiasm and teamwork skills.
- Strong relationship‑building ability with clients and colleagues, and experience supporting junior lawyers.
- Strong commercial awareness and willingness to participate in group training.
- At the Senior Associate or Principal Associate level: experience in coaching, supervising and mentoring junior lawyers.

How to prepare for a job interview at Eversheds Sutherland
✨Know Your Corporate Law Inside Out
Make sure you brush up on the latest trends and developments in corporate law. Be prepared to discuss recent cases or changes in legislation that could impact clients. This shows your passion for the field and your commitment to staying informed.
✨Showcase Your Client Management Skills
Think of specific examples where you've successfully managed client demands or navigated tight deadlines. Highlight your ability to deliver excellent client service, as this is crucial for the role. Use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ure your responses.
✨Demonstrate Teamwork and Mentorship Experience
Since the role involves supporting junior lawyers, be ready to share your experiences in coaching or mentoring. Discuss how you've contributed to team success and fostered a collaborative environment. This will resonate well with their emphasis on teamwork.
✨Align with Their Values
Familiarise yourself with the firm's commitment to diversity and inclusion. Be prepared to discuss how you can contribute to these values and support flexible working arrangements. Showing that you align with their culture can set you apart from other candidates.
